你查询的IP:[114.80.39.171]  地理位置:中国–上海–上海电信/IDC机房

最新查询124.47.2.126 124.196.30.147 117.121.23.166 203.90.115.41 123.64.54.221 123.4.120.119 118.144.178.234 120.137.127.1 118.192.205.228 118.124.15.12 114.80.39.171 123.253.209.232 124.248.29.197 118.102.16.224 118.88.128.245 120.137.185.93 123.101.67.90 120.94.36.131 117.76.12.163 59.80.18.176 210.72.55.66 203.119.32.236 119.18.224.54 202.127.224.173 202.90.252.49 124.47.72.72 120.119.237.32 202.38.149.56 121.59.2.135 119.248.243.204 203.90.172.16 123.49.128.89